<p>Fluvial sediments have collectively formed about 900,000 km<sup>2</sup> of deltaic land since Holocene sea-level rise slowed down. The rate at which deltas have retained fluvial sediment to build deltaic land, however, has varied greatly between different deltas. Here we quantify sediment retention in the delta topset and foreset for 3,556 deltas globally. We estimate retention from data on delta morphology and cross-sectional area, combined with WBMSed data on fluvial suspended sediment supply. Deltas, on average, retain 25±2% (standard error of the mean) of the fluvial sediment in their topset and 31±2% in their foreset. Because topset sediment retention reduces the sediment delivery to the river mouth, it sets up a feedback with processes that build delta morphology. Waves reduce topset sediment retention whereas tides increase it. Tide dominated deltas retain 61±24% on their topset, on average, compared to 21±3% and 24±2% for river- and wave-dominated deltas, respectively. Larger deltas trap more sediment, but not in comparison to their larger sediment loads, making them relatively inefficient sediment traps.</p>

Sediment traps are crucial elements for flood protection in mountain rivers with high sediment transport capacity. Existing structures often interrupt the channel connectivity. Ideally, a sediment trap should be permeable for bed load during non-hazardous floods and ensure sediment retention during hazardous discharges. A new sediment trap concept, fulfilling these requirements was recently developed and tested in a laboratory flume. A guiding channel trough the deposition area is combined with a slot check dam having an upstream bar screen with bottom clearance. This study aims to validate the proposed concept with a finer sediment mixture on an experimental set-up. Furthermore, we provide improved recommendations for bar screen design regarding minimal bar spacing and the range of applicable clearance heights. Optimal bar spacing and clearance heights of the bar screen are determined through individual tests of the bar screen with steady discharges and varying sediment supply intensity. The best performing bar screen configuration is subsequently tested in combination with a slot check dam using a flood hydrograph to simulate the influence of quasi-unsteady discharge. The proposed concept corresponds to a combined mechanical-hydraulic control and works well for a large range of grain sizes, if the bar screen is correctly adapted.

The character of bed sediments reflects fluvial processes and the dynamics of material transport in fluvial (dis)continuum systems. The approach in this study was based on the measurement of the five largest boulders located within a channel, and on the observation of changes in their size in the longitudinal profi le of headwater streams Kobylská and Pulčínský potok. All three axes (dimensions) of the five largest boulders were measured at 10 ± 1m intervals of the longitudinal profile. The resulting trends in a particle-size index reflect the character of sediment delivery into the channel segment. The largest boulders were observed in channel sections with a strong interaction of slope processes. But local lithological conditions affect changes of the mean value of the particle-size index of the largest boulders. The role of slope processes can be accentuated by the presence of uniform sandstone lithology of the studied bed particles. In the lithology built by claystone layers the role of slope processes has problematic identification. The main reason is erodible character of claystone layers which affects sediment supply of finer particles from adjacent slopes into the channel segment.

In tide-dominated estuaries, maximum-turbidity zones (MTZs) are common and prominent features, characterized by a peak in suspended-sediment concentration (SSC) associated with estuarine processes. The Brazilian Amazon coast includes many estuaries, experiencing macrotidal conditions. MTZs are expected to occur and are crucial for sediment delivery to the longest continuous mangrove belt of the world. The area is under influence of the Amazon River plume (ARP), the main SSC source, as local rivers do not deliver substantial sediment supply. To assess the processes that allow the ARP to supply sediment to the estuaries and mangrove belt along the Amazon coast, the results from previous individual studies within five Amazon estuaries (Mocajuba, Taperaçu, Caeté, Urumajó and Gurupi) were compared with regards to SSC, salinity, morphology and tidal propagation. This comparison reinforces that these estuaries are subject to similar regional climate and tidal variations, but that their dynamics differ in terms of distance from the Amazon River mouth, importance of the local river sediment source, and morphology of the estuarine setting. The Urumajó, Caeté and Gurupi are hypersynchronous estuaries where perennial, classic MTZs are observed with SSC > 1 g·L−1. This type of estuary results in transport convergence and MTZ formation, which are suggested to be the main processes promoting mud accumulation in the Amazonian estuaries and therefore the main means of mud entrapment in the mangrove belt. The Mocajuba and the Taperaçu estuaries showed synchronous and hyposynchronous processes, respectively, and do not present classic MTZs. In these cases, the proximity to the ARP for the Mocajuba and highly connected tidal channels for the Taperaçu estuary, assure substantial mud supply into these estuaries. This study shows the strong dependence of the estuaries and mangrove belt on sediment supply from the ARP, helping to understand the fate of Amazon River sediments and providing insights into the mechanisms providing sediment to estuaries and mangroves around the world, especially under the influence of big rivers.

Summary: The concept of “sense of coherence” (SOC) has been widely recognized since it was first introduced by Antonovsky. The originality and usefulness of the SOC scale and its relation to other psychosocial measures has been the subject of lively debate. The aim of this paper was to test for associations between SOC and work-related psychosocial factors (mainly the Job Demand-Control model), general living conditions, education, and social network factors. Cross-sectional data from a population-based sample of 1782 rural males from nine counties in Sweden were analyzed with a multiple regression technique. The subjects were occupationally active at inclusion and the mean age was 50 years (range 40-60). SOC was assessed with the original 29-item questionnaire. Psychosocial variables and lifestyle factors were assessed using questionnaires and structured interviews. The mean SOC among the subjects was 152.3 (standard deviation, 19.4). A strong negative correlation was found between SOC and job demand, whereas a positive correlation with job control was demonstrated. A positive correlation with general living conditions and with social support was also found. However, there was no correlation to education and occupation. Thus, SOC was shown to be strongly correlated to work-related psychosocial factors and social support, but independent of sociodemographic factors.

Pathological changes in the prostate gland occur commonly with advancing age including inflammation, atrophy, hyperplasia and carcinoma and a change in volume is also evident. Estimation of volume of prostate may be useful in a variety of clinical settings. A cross-sectional descriptive study was designed to see the changes in volume of the prostate with advancing age and done in the Department of Anatomy, Dhaka Medical College, Dhaka from August 2006 to June 2007. The study was performed on 70 post-mortem human prostates collected from the unclaimed dead bodies that were under examination in the Department of Forensic Medicine, Dhaka Medical College, Dhaka. The samples were divided into three age groups; group A (10-20 years), group B (21-40 years) and group C (41-70 years). Volume of the sample was measured by using the ellipsoid formula. The mean ± SD volume of prostate was 7.68 ± 3.64 cm3 in group A, 10.61 ± 3.99 cm3 in group B and 15.40 ± 6.31 cm3 in group C. Mean difference in volume between group A and group C, group B and group C were statistically significant (p<0.001). Statistically significant positive correlation was found between age and volume of prostate (r = + 0.579, p < 0.001). Key Words: Prostate; volume; Bangladeshi. DOI: 10.3329/imcj.v4i2.6501Ibrahim Med. Background: The visual evoked potentials (VEP) is a valuable tool to document occult lesions of the central visual channels especially within the optic nerve. Objectives: The purpose of the present study was to observe the findings of first few cases of VEP done in the neurophysiology department of the National Institute of Neurosciences (NINS), Dhaka, Bangladesh. Methodology: This cross-sectional study was conducted in the Department of Neurophysiology at the National Institute of Neurosciences and Hospital, Dhaka, Bangladesh from September 2017 to March 2020. All patients referred to the Neurophysiology Department of NINS for VEP were included. Pattern reversal VEPs were done using standard protocol set by International Federation of Clinical Neurophysiology (IFCN). Results: The mean age of the study population was 30.70 (±12.11) years (6-68 years) with 31 (46.3%) male and 36 (53.7%) female patients. The mean duration of illness was 8.71 (±1.78) months (3 days- 120 months). Most common presenting symptom was blurring of vision (37.3%) and dimness of vision (32.8%). Patterned VEP revealed mixed type (both demyelinating and axonal) of abnormality in most cases [29(43.35)]. The most common clinical diagnosis was multiple sclerosis (29.85%) and optic neuropathy (26.87%). In the clinically suspected cases of multiple sclerosis, optic neuropathy and optic neuritis most of the cases of VEP were abnormal and the p value is 0.04 in optic neuropathy and optic neuritis. Conclusion: The commonest presentation of the patients in this series were blurring of vision and dimness of vision. The most common clinical diagnosis for which VEP was asked for, was optic neuritis and multiple sclerosis. Most abnormalities were of mixed pattern (demyelinating and axonal). Background: The amniotic fluid is fundamental for proper fetal development and growth. Ultrasound visualization of the amniotic fluid permits both subjective and objective estimates of the amniotic fluid. Objective: The objective of this study was to determine the reference values of normal single deepest pocket (SDP) – upper and lower limits, mean SDP and variation of the SDP with gestational age among Igbo women of South-Eastern Nigeria extraction carrying uncomplicated singleton pregnancy. Methodology: This was a prospective cross sectional study involving 400 women carrying uncomplicated singleton pregnancies and who were sure of the date of the first day of their last menstrual period. The single deepest pocket / maximum vertical pool were determined once at presentation at the hospital.. The study was conducted from January 1st to December 31st 2015. The second author carried out all the scanning. The SDP was obtained. Results: The womens’ mean and median ages were the same at 28 years. The gestational age range of the pregnancies was 14-41 weeks. The mean SDP was 5.8cm, while the 5th and 95th percentiles were 3.3cm and 8.5cm respectively. There was no difference in the mean SDP in both term and preterm. There was irregular but continuous rise of mean SDP to a peak of 6.8cm at gestational age of 39 weeks. In conclusion, the participants had a mean SDP of 5.8cm. There was also a positive correlation between SDP and Gestational age. We therefore recommend a longitudinal study to assess perinatal outcome and abnormal amniotic fluid volume among Igbo women of South-Eastern Nigeria. Tympanoplasty is one of the most performed procedures in ENT. The aggressiveness of its microscopic approach has led otologists to adopt the endoscopic approach as a less invasive alternative. The purpose of this work is to appreciate the advantages and disadvantages of this surgical technique. We conducted a prospective descriptive cross-sectional study on 20 interventions within the ENT department of August the 20th 1953 Hospital of Casablanca from April 2019 to June 2019. The average age of operated patients was 36.3 years. Perforations were unilateral in (71%) of the cases with a predominance of the anterior (29%) and subtotal (36%) locations. The tympanoplasties were performed by 3 different senior otologic surgeons, and were left in (57%). The mean operating time was (59.5 min) and the mean anesthesia duration was 75.1 min. Intraoperative vision allowed us to fully visualize the margins of all perforations (100%) and anatomical structures of the middle ear in almost all interventions. The first procedures carried out were filled with difficulties whose management of intraoperative bleeding was the main one in (42.8%) of the cases. (57%) procedures were described as easy. No complication was detected intraoperatively or immediately postoperatively. Endoscopic tympanoplasty has several advantages, including: Minimally invasive approach to the middle ear; panoramic perioperative vision; Gain of operating time; decrease in the duration of anesthesia; Valuable educational tool; postoperative comfort; Decrease in hospital stay and early return to daily activities; Better aesthetic rendering; cost and transportability. However, we also note a number of disadvantages of endoscopic tympanoplasty, particularly: performing the procedure with one hand; difficulty passing through the EAC; 2D vision that alters the perception of depth; management of intraoperative bleeding; fogging; learning curve.

Pleural effusion is present when there is >15ml of fluid is accumulated in the pleural space. It can be divided into two types; exudative and transudative pleural effusion. Tuberculosis and parapneumonic effusion are the common cause of exudative pleural effusion whereas heart failure accounts for most of the cases of transudative pleural effusion. This study was a hospital based cross sectional study performed at Nepal Medical College during the period of January 2016-December 2016. A total of 50 patients who fulfilled the inclusion criteria were enrolled. Pleural effusion was confirmed by clinical examination and radiology. After confirmation of pleural effusion, pleural fluid was aspirated and was analysed for protein, LDH, cholesterol. The Heffner criteria was compared with Light criteria to classify exudative or transudative pleural effusion. Among 50 patients, 30 were male and 20 were female. The mean age of patient was 45.4±21.85 years. The sensitivity and specificity of using Light criteria to detect the two type of pleural effusion was 100% and 90.9%, whereas using Heffner criteria was 94.87%, 100% respectively(P<0.01). There are variety of causes for development of pleural effusion and no one criteria is definite to differentiate between exudative or transudative effusion. In this study Light criteria was more sensitive whereas Heffner criteria was more specific to classify exudative pleural effusion. Hence a combination of criteria might be useful in case where there is difficulty to identify the cause of pleural effusion.
